Transaction 17ce14de86d884884c742e1059371ea60bfd1b00e38439c342c673c9603577b8
1 Input
1 Output
-
17ce14de86d884884c742e1059371ea60bfd1b00e38439c342c673c9603577b8:0
- value
- 79039
- script pubkey
- OP_0 OP_PUSHBYTES_20 e397060bb22b99ace3fe51f4adecc98aa020b6f6
- address
- bc1quwtsvzaj9wv6ecl72862mmxf32szpdhk6r8j73